This four-image collage presents a cohesive set of wedding flowers that could easily grace a Romford ceremony, with each frame highlighting how orchids and roses repeat across the day. In the top-left photograph, the focus rests on the bride's mid-section, her white lace gown forming a gentle, textural canvas for a luxuriant cascade bouquet. Long, arching stems of white phalaenopsis orchids with pale yellow centers drift downward among blush pink garden roses, pale lavender stock, soft tufts of baby's breath, and flowing greenery. Deeper pink, almost fuchsia, spiky blooms thread through the design, giving subtle energy and contrast, like a splash of colour against the historic brick streets near Romford Market. The top-right image zooms in on the groom's dark suit, showing a single white orchid boutonniere pinned to his lapel above a bold red tie and patterned shirt. The orchid is trimmed with little clusters of baby's breath and fine green sprigs, bound in a narrow white satin ribbon so it sits neatly against the jacket, perfectly echoing the bride's bouquet. In the bottom-left frame, the same boutonniere is laid flat on a light beige, textured cloth that suggests linen or burlap, allowing every detail of the white petals, tiny gypsophila florets, and tidy ribbon wrap to be clearly seen, as though ready for delivery to a wedding party getting ready in Gidea Park. The bottom-right photo reveals a coordinated centerpiece, bursting from a white woven cylinder vase placed on a white surface. White orchids, soft pink roses, lilac stock, baby's breath, greenery, and those signature deep pink spikes are arranged with care, accompanied by two white woven spheres, creating a refined table setting ideal for a Romford reception or intimate dinner at a local venue.
